A rare and intimate window into the past, A Pictorial History of Moe and District presents a vivid photographic chronicle of one of Victoria's most distinctive regional communities, capturing the spirit of a town shaped by coal, industry, and pioneering settlement. Through a carefully curated collection of historical photographs, the volume documents the streets, buildings, people, and events that defined Moe and its surrounding districts across the decades, offering an irreplaceable visual record for historians and locals alike. Rooted in the tradition of Australian regional history, this work illustrates the transformation of a rural landscape into a thriving community, weaving together the threads of everyday life, civic pride, and cultural memory. Each image serves as a primary source, bearing silent testimony to the generations who built and sustained this Gippsland town — leaving the reader to wonder what further stories remain hidden just beyond the frame.
